The value of the reheat factor is of the order of_____________?
Correct answer: C. 1.1 to 1.5
- A. 0.8 to 1.0
- B. 1.0 to 1.05
- C. 1.1 to 1.5
- D. above 1.5
Explanation
The reheat factor is greater than unity because the cumulative actual stage enthalpy drops exceed the overall isentropic enthalpy drop. Typical values are approximately 1.1 to 1.5.
